Subject: Re: [PATCH] mac80211: cancel scan in ieee80211_restart_hw if software scan pending

On Tue, 2010-08-31 at 15:25 -0400, John W. Linville wrote:
> This function exists to clean-up after a hardware error or something
> similar.  The restart is accomplished using the same infrastructure used
> to resume after a suspend.  The suspend path cancels running scans, so
> it seems appropriate to do that here as well for software-based scans.
> If a hardware-based scan is pending, issue a warning message since this
> indicates that the drivers has failed to clean-up after itself.

Makes sense.

I guess unrelated to this, I wonder if we should warn in the suspend
case as well, rather than doing it unconditionally. Hmm.
